Job Title: Electronic Payments Rep.
Company: National Bank of California
Location: Los Angeles, CA

Description:
National Bank of California is seeking a person to administer all ACH and Remote Deposit products including compilation of required documentation and completion of agreements between the Bank and Originators, Third Party Processors and other customers. Responds to all customer and Bank employees regarding the Bank's ACH and Remote Deposit products. MUST have a basic knowledge of ACH system and Check21 Act. Knowledge of common concepts and procedures within the field of Electronic Payments is important. Knowledge of general banking concepts is required. This person will perform a variety of tasks so a wide degree of creativity and latitude is expected. Should be able to multi-task and rely on experience and knowledge to accomplish assigned tasks and/or goals. Position requires some travel -- from Ventura County to Orange County -- for onsite Remote Deposit installations. Reports to and assists the Director of Electronic Payments as directed.

Job Title: ELECTRONIC BANKING REP I
Company: Union Bank
Location: San Diego, CA

Description:
Title: ELECTRONIC BANKING REP I Location: CALIFORNIA-SAN DIEGO Invest in your career. Invest in your future. At Union Bank, our people are our greatest asset. We are one of the largest banks in California with a longstanding reputation for professional training and career development. In addition to investing in our employees, Union Bank has established a generous community reinvestment program that works to uplift communities and watch them grow. We invest in a diverse workforce as our employees come from many different backgrounds, bringing with them different experiences and perspectives. Become part of a team where community, diversity, and exceptional service are part of everyones job. Invest in you! Depending upon experience and qualifications, position can be grade 38 or 39. Entry level Electronic Banking position. Monitors, verifies and ensures timely incoming and outgoing ACH file transmissions to the Federal Reserve Bank and between departments, using TSO, CA7, Bulk Data and PEP . Researches and resolves online rejects and returns. Edits, balances and verifies all ACH activity flowing through PEP . Process Federal Government reclamations for Federal Recurring payments. Cross training in Electronic Banking Customer Service unit. Schedule is 3:30 p. m. to 12:00 a. m. , Monday through Friday. Position requires the ability to use PC-Windows based applications, type accurately 45 wpm, work with numbers and online systems, use ten-key by touch and work independently in a high production environment. Must have well developed organizational, analytical and interpersonal skills. Must have the ability to work well under pressure. Must be able to lift 25 lbs. Job Title: Electronic Banking Specialist -
Company:
Location: Honolulu, HI

Description:
Electronic Banking Specialist - 0900451 Description Position Overview The Electronic Banking Specialist position prepares, analyzes and validates periodic financial reports tracking profitability, revenue monitoring and ATM transaction trends. This position is also responsible for miscellaneous/adhoc reporting and data gathering in support of key departmental initiatives and mandates. Independently performs problem resolution initiatives for vendor and business customers. Position Responsibilities Statistical Analysis Compiles and analyzes statistical data relative to departments' productivity. Creates and analyzes various reports/data to assist in ATM strategies and performance. Investigates, analyzes and reports on changing trends to enable management to proactively make strategy changes to minimize potential losses. Evaluates and prepares monthly departmental statistical and financial reports for executive management review and for Electronic Banking division using various computer software and mainframe (PC SurePay) interface. Follows-up unusual fluctuations of the divisions budget variances. Compliance Monitors and researches product compliance issues following prescribed procedures related to write-offs and losses. Maintains, reviews and validates monthly project status and statistics reports and audit/examination/vendor management tickler system reports. Researches and updates ACH, ATM and Credit Union Reports on various reporting systems for clients participating in Electronic Banking programs. Maintains applications and their related databases, especially ATM Manager Pro (via Access) database which is used to monitor ATM profitability. Operations Evaluates, recommends and implements revisions to existing EBD billing processes on an on-going basis. Prepares and processes Electronic Banking Division's billings, including ShareCard, network, royalty, ATM, Pacific Payments Alliance, and inter-ACH via mail and settlement via the ACH. Researches and resolves discrepancies referred by financial institutions, networks, management and landlords. Follows-up and resolves product information problems, complaints discrepancies and outstanding items for internal, and external customers and vendors. Prepares and processes checks and tickets to clear and off-set settlement, billings, and write-offs for various Electronic Banking products. Performs daily balancing and reconcilement of general ledger accounts for ATMs using PC and Host systems to execute electronic entries. Demonstrates and maintains working knowledge of Bank of Hawaii's Electronic Banking products, platforms, procedures, software and equipment. Administrative Support Provides project support and assists in operations and client service support. Participates in special projects and initiatives. Provides assistance for researching information on various projects required for management by programming. Orders and maintains supplies and arranges for travel of individuals within Electronic Banking. Primary administrator for department's Time Online for all employees. Qualifications The qualified applicant for the Electronic Banking Specialist position meets the following basic qualifications: College degree or 4 years related work experience 5 years work experience in a financial services, accounting or finance industry or equivalent Demonstrated experience in reconciling, financial reporting, database management and report writing, project support, planning and customer service skills to all types of internal and external customers Typing and computer skills, detail oriented, self starter and possesses analytical skills Uses PC proficiently (Microsoft office suite with emphasis on database software such as MS Access).
